announce |
to tell or make known. |
battle |
a fight between two opposing sides. |
born |
a past participle of bear1. |
brain |
the organ in the body that controls thought, movement, and feeling. The brain is inside the skull. |
erase |
to remove by rubbing away. |
harm |
hurt or injury. |
lawn |
an area of land where people plant grass and cut it to keep it short. |
originally |
at first. |
passenger |
a person who is not driving but travels in an automobile, bus, train, or other vehicle. |
peek |
to look for a short time or in secret. |
quit |
to stop doing something. |
quite |
completely. |
rifle |
a gun that has a long barrel and that is shot from the shoulder. |
screen |
a piece of material made of woven wire. A screen covers a window, door, or other opening. |
voice |
the sound that comes from your mouth when you speak or sing. |
